    Finding the right defense attorney is crucial for navigating legal challenges effectively. Start by assessing qualifications, experience, and communication style to ensure you select a lawyer who aligns with your needs.

    Assess Attorney Qualifications and Specializations

    When searching for a defense attorney, qualifications and experience are paramount. Look for attorneys who specialize in the type of case you are facing, whether it’s criminal defense, DUI, or white-collar crime. An attorney with a proven track record in similar cases can offer valuable insights and strategies.

    • Check for a valid law license in your state.

    • Review their educational background.

    • Look for any special certifications in criminal law.

    • Assess their years of practice in the field.

    Defense Attorney Fee Structures Explained

    Understanding the various fee structures of defense attorneys is crucial for making an informed decision when seeking legal representation. This section breaks down the common pricing models, including hourly rates, flat fees, and contingency arrangements, helping you navigate the financial aspects of hiring the right attorney for your case.

    Understanding how a defense attorney charges for their services is crucial in your selection process. Some attorneys charge hourly, while others may work on a flat fee basis. Knowing the fee structure helps avoid unexpected costs.

    • Inquire about initial consultation fees.

    • Understand their billing practices.

    • Ask if they offer payment plans.
